If Crestview was feeling good fresh off their 3-0 takedown of Plymouth on Tuesday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Cougars fell just short of the St. Paul Flyers by a score of 3-2 on Thursday. The Cougars' defeat signaled the end of their three-game winning streak.
Crestview took St. Paul into a fifth set but they suffered a heartbreaking nine-point loss.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-17, 25-22, 25-27, 26-28, 15-6.
Zoe Kuhn paced Crestview's offense, picking up 17 kills. Kuhn got some help from Kloe Morrison and her 21 assists. Kuhn was also solid from the service line: she led the team with four aces.
Among those leading the charge was Ryleigh Mansfield Bush, who had 11 digs and three aces. Kegney Stoll also deserves some recognition as she posted her first assists of the season.
Crestview's loss dropped their record down to 9-4. As for St. Paul, their record now sits at 5-2.
